Common Beech Tree Pruning Jobs
Beech Tree Pruning - selective trimming to maintain tree health and structure.
Thinning and Shaping - reducing canopy density for better light and airflow.
Deadwood Removal - removing damaged or diseased branches to prevent decay.
Height Reduction - safely lowering tree height to prevent interference with structures or power lines.
Crown Cleaning - clearing out crossing or rubbing branches to improve overall tree vitality.
Maintenance Pruning - regular trims to promote healthy growth and aesthetic appeal.
Beech Tree Pruning Questions
Why is pruning a beech tree important? Proper pruning helps maintain the tree's health, shape, and safety by removing dead or damaged branches.
When is the best time to prune a beech tree? The ideal time is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
What types of pruning are recommended for beech trees? Crown thinning, shaping, and removal of problematic branches are common pruning methods for beech trees.
Are there any risks to pruning a beech tree? Improper pruning can lead to weak growth or disease, so professional techniques are recommended for best results.
